Learning Goals

Studying this chapter will enable you to

OBJ1.jpg Describe the basic properties of the main types of normal galaxies.
OBJ2.jpg Discuss the distance-measurement techniques that enable astronomers to map the universe beyond the Milky Way.
OBJ3.jpg Describe how galaxies clump into clusters.
OBJ4.jpg State Hubble’s law and explain how it is used to derive distances to the most remote objects in the observable universe.
OBJ5.jpg Specify the basic differences between active and normal galaxies.
OBJ6.jpg Describe the important features of active galaxies.
OBJ7.jpg Explain what drives the central engine thought to power all active galaxies.
